Installation of suspended toilet bowls with block installation
First you need to make markup. With the help of a tape measure and a level, we measure the height of the structure and find points for fastening. Using a perforator, we make holes and fix the dowels
We install a hidden tank, twist the drain hole (since this procedure can be carried out differently for different manufacturers, be sure to pay attention to the instructions). Be sure to check that all seals are present.
After that, the hidden tank can be connected by water.
In the holes already made, we attach the pins that will hold the toilet (usually these are already included with it). We install the bowl, at the end we fix the drain hose with clamps if necessary.

How to install a toilet with a hidden cistern with a frame installation
This procedure is somewhat more complicated. First you need to assemble the entire frame on which the hidden tank is attached. At the same time, pre-adjust the dimensions of the frame.
Installing a hidden toilet cistern should adhere to the following principles:
- The drain button should be located a meter from the floor;
- The height of the toilet bowl should be 40-45 cm;
- The sewer outlet should be at a level of 22-25 cm;
- The distance between the mounts for the bowl is determined by the location of its eyes.
The assembled structure is installed strictly vertically and horizontally. First, do not forget to check the slope of the wall with a plumb line, if there is one, you should definitely take it into account.
We attach the installation frame to the wall and mark the points where it is necessary to drill holes for fasteners. We install the frame, preferably, attach it to the wall and to the floor. Do not forget to check the correct installation with a level.
We supply water. This can be done either from the side or from above. Modern installation models allow you to choose the connection point
Please note that it is undesirable to use a standard flexible eyeliner, since it is unreliable, and to replace it, you will have to disassemble the entire structure. Plastic pipes are used for water supply
The hidden tank itself must be lined with insulating material (usually already included in the kit) to prevent condensation.
Next, we connect the outlet of the toilet bowl to the sewer, for this a corrugated pipe is useful.Don't forget to check the tightness of the connections.
After that, you can start assembling a decorative plasterboard structure. First you need to close all the holes with special plugs so that construction debris does not get into them, and install the pins on which the toilet bowl will be attached. To assemble the decorative structure, moisture-resistant drywall with a thickness of at least 1 millimeter is used.
If the plasterboard construction was finished with ceramic tiles, at least ten days must pass before the installation of the bowl! After that, we adjust the release of the bowl to the sewer hole. Places where the bowl will come into contact with ceramic tiles are treated with a silicone-based sealant. We hang the bowl on the pins and tighten the nuts. After that, you can conduct a test drain of water.
Installing an attached toilet bowl with a block installation

To begin with, the location of the knee is fixed, the release of the bowl is treated with a special technical ointment, the toilet is tried on at the installation site, marking the points of the mounting holes, the bowl is removed and the fasteners included in the kit are installed. Sanitaryware is put in place, and its outlet is installed in a fan pipe. A connecting cuff is installed at the junction. Installation of a hidden drain tank is carried out according to the instructions. The drain button is installed in the technological hole. The last step is to test the functionality of the structure.
Tips:
- If the attached toilet began to leak, most likely the problem is in the joint seams treated with sealant. Check the connection with the fan pipe;
- Under the drain button, it is worthwhile to provide a technological hatch (it can be made completely invisible thanks to the tile), this will greatly facilitate the repair work;
- Install main filters for water purification, this will extend the life of the system;
- The drain is mounted at an angle of 45 degrees, otherwise the water will stagnate;
- Often the cause of leaking flush-mounted drain tanks is improper installation of gaskets, be especially careful with them.
Type of toilet outlet
The comfort of using the toilet does not depend on the type of sewer outlet, no external differences were noticed either. However, the location of the sewer hole and its dimensions should be considered when choosing a toilet bowl.
For the consumer, toilet bowls are represented by three main types:
- With horizontal outlet. Such models are chosen if the socket of the sewer pipe is located at a height of 5-10 cm from the floor.
- With vertical outlet. The design of the toilet suggests the presence of a drain hole directed downwards, which allows you to save space in the bathroom as much as possible. However, it should be understood that such an arrangement of the sewer hole can only be found in private individual houses. Apartment buildings have a different structure of the sewer system.
- with oblique release. Most of the manufactured toilet bowls have such a tap; they are connected to a socket, which is located at a small distance from the floor level or at an angle to it.

Methods for mounting corner toilets
According to the type of installation, floor and hanging toilet bowls are distinguished. The first option involves the placement and installation of the drain mechanism directly on the floor, in the second case - on the wall.
The installation of a floor-standing corner toilet is carried out according to the standard scheme, so special knowledge and time are not required when deciding how to install a corner toilet.
Hanging corner toilet involves the use of a special corner installation in the form of a metal frame. During the installation process, a sewer pipe, a water pipe are brought to it and a drain tank is installed.
The installation can be located in a pre-arranged niche in the wall or just in the corner. In any case, the design implies a complete disguise of the drain tank and the summed communications.

Another type of corner toilets is the side-mounted model.Similar plumbing is also located in the corner, but the vertical axis in this case has a direction along one of the walls, and not diagonally. The thicket of the toilet bowl in such designs has an asymmetric offset, which allows you to install the toilet close to the wall.
Depending on the type of water supply to the drain tank, there are models with bottom and side supply. The first option has some advantage due to the silent intake of water into the drain tank.
An attached-type toilet bowl for installation in the corner of a bathroom also allows you to hide the elements of communication systems in a wall or a special bedside table, which most often comes with a toilet bowl.

Short modules

The shortened module allows you to install the device even under the window, and at the same time position the flush key horizontally so that it does not interfere with the toilet lid when opening.
A distinctive feature of this compact subspecies of modules is a frame shortened in height (82–83 cm instead of 113 cm). Such modules are suitable for installation in front of windows, under the door of a sanitary cabinet, hanging bathroom furniture and in other places where a low engineering module is required. In this case, the flush panel (if we are talking about a toilet) is located at the end. Similar systems are available from Geberit, TECE, Viega, Grohe and other companies.

Features of corner toilets
The corner toilet is a standard floor or wall-mounted design with a triangular cistern.

Triangular cistern for corner toilet
The advantages of this model are:
- significant space savings in the room due to the use of the "dead" zone behind the tank of the standard model;
- small overall dimensions. The corner toilet is compact and can be located in rooms of any size;
- uniqueness. Corner designs are not widely popular, and look more interesting than standard plumbing.
However, before choosing, one should take into account some negative characteristics of corner models, which include:
- the need for strong walls in the toilet room, since in most cases the cistern is mounted on the wall;
- the need to transfer communications. As a rule, in apartments of multi-storey buildings, sewerage and water supply systems are not designed for corner models, as they are located only along one or two walls.
Which exit is better: straight or oblique?
It should be noted that toilets with oblique or horizontal outlets are interchangeable in most cases, so the difference between them is small. But if it is quite easy to convert a direct model to an oblique one, then doing it the other way around is much more difficult.To do this, you will have to organize an additional elbow, which complicates the design of the outlet, as well as the already complicated process of sealing the joints (there is a high probability of residual water standing in the additional elbow).
In addition, it will not do without changing the installation location of the toilet bowl if the distance from the wall of the toilet bowl with a horizontal outlet that stood before this was minimal. You will have to prepare a new platform for attaching the bowl to the floor. In modern technology for the construction of residential buildings, sewers are mounted mainly under toilet bowls with an oblique outlet. Although another location of the sewage system is gaining popularity - under the toilets of the horizontal outlet.


And if we compare the models with each other, without taking into account their interchangeability, then a toilet with an oblique type of outlet is considered a more versatile system, since such a bowl can be connected to a sewer pipeline located at an angle of 0 to 35 degrees relative to it. That is, some errors in the location of the sewer line are permissible, which is quite possible during the construction of high-rise buildings, when not everything turns out strictly according to the project as a result of previously unplanned circumstances
In addition, the process of installing a plumbing fixture with an oblique outlet is simpler, due to the lack of a strict point for its installation and connection to the sewer. This cannot be said about the analogue with a horizontal outlet - here the outlet must be located with the connection on the sewer strictly opposite each other.


Description of the "release"
The drain hole that connects to the sewer is the outlet of the toilet. Connection is carried out in three ways:
- A universal option for connecting to a drain system, when the drain hole and its pipe are in a horizontal plane, on the same level. Finnish plumbing and Swedish models are produced.
- The drain pipe of the structure is directed to the floor, where the sewer wiring is hidden. Distributed in houses built in Soviet times (Stalin).
- The drain hole of the model is connected to the drainage pipe at a 45° angle - this is the oblique outlet direction. Models are produced by manufacturers in the Russian Federation.
Which outlet of the toilet is suitable will be prompted by the selected design of the sewer wiring. If its installation is entrusted to a specialist, then his recommendations will not interfere in the same way.
